Performance in UK Outdoor Conditions
Outdoor paving surfaces must withstand a wide range of environmental conditions including rainfall, frost, and temperature fluctuations. Kensington Pearl porcelain slabs are manufactured using vitrification processes that create a dense and highly durable material designed for long term outdoor use.
The surface offers excellent slip resistance with an R11 rating, helping maintain safe footing during wet weather conditions. Because porcelain is non porous, it does not absorb moisture in the same way as many natural stones. This reduces the risk of frost damage during winter months and prevents staining caused by organic debris.
These characteristics make porcelain paving particularly suitable for British gardens where weather conditions can change frequently throughout the year.
Low Maintenance Outdoor Flooring
One of the main advantages of porcelain paving is its low maintenance nature. Unlike some traditional paving materials, vitrified porcelain does not require sealing and resists algae, moss, and staining more effectively.
Routine sweeping and occasional cleaning with water are normally enough to keep porcelain paving looking fresh. This makes it an ideal choice for busy households or rental properties where long term maintenance needs to remain simple and cost effective.

Installation Considerations
Proper installation is essential to ensure porcelain paving performs reliably over time. Because porcelain slabs are dense and low absorption, they require suitable preparation and installation techniques.
A typical installation process includes:
- Preparing a stable sub base using compacted MOT Type 1
- Applying a full mortar bed to support each slab
- Using a porcelain primer on the underside of the slab
- Maintaining consistent spacing between slabs
- Finishing joints using a suitable grout or jointing compound
Following correct installation practices ensures the paving remains stable and visually aligned for many years.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are Kensington Pearl porcelain paving slabs made from?
Kensington Pearl slabs are made from vitrified porcelain which is produced using high temperature manufacturing processes. This creates a dense and durable material suitable for outdoor paving.
Are porcelain paving slabs suitable for UK weather?
Yes. Porcelain paving is frost resistant, weather resistant, and designed to perform reliably in outdoor conditions including rain and seasonal temperature changes.
Do porcelain paving slabs require sealing?
No. Porcelain is non porous and does not require sealing. This helps reduce long term maintenance compared with many natural stone paving materials.
Are porcelain paving slabs slippery when wet?
Kensington Pearl slabs have an R11 slip resistant rating which helps provide good grip underfoot during wet weather conditions.
How long do porcelain paving slabs last?
When installed correctly, porcelain paving slabs can last for many years because they resist staining, fading, and moisture absorption.
Can porcelain paving be used for pathways?
Yes. The durable and slip resistant surface makes porcelain paving suitable for garden paths, patios, terraces, and other outdoor areas.
How do you clean porcelain paving?
Routine sweeping and occasional washing with water usually keeps porcelain paving clean. The non porous surface helps prevent stains and moss growth.
